Pre-Columbian:Metal/Gold, Circular Breast plate Costa Rica Circular Breast plate
Costa Rica or Panama
A.D. 700 - 1500
Gold, Weight 72.6 grams
Diameter 6 ½ in.

The Hendershott Collection
Pre-Columbian:Metal/Gold, Circular Breastplate Costa Rica Circular Breastplate
Costa Rica or Panama
A.D. 700 - 1500
Gold, Weight 18.9 grams
Diameter 5 3/8 in.

The Hendershott Collection
